The difference is that full-time biweekly salaried employees will be paid for 80 hours each payday. Full-time semi-monthly employees will receive 86.67 hours of pay per paycheck. The hourly difference occurs because of the distinction in the number of paychecks the employees will receive.
-
Methods of Calculating With full-time equivalents, you should assume one FTE will work a 40 hour workweek. A quick and easy method of calculating monthly hours is to multiply 40 hours per week by 4 weeks, yielding 160 hours for the month.
-
A bi-weekly schedule consists of 26 pay periods in a year. Each pay cycle generally consists of 80 hours for a full-time employee.

Biweekly pay dates occur every other week, and semi-monthly pay is paid out on two specific dates a month (e.g. every 5th and 20th of the month). There are 26 pay periods per year. Employees are paid on a specific day, e.g. every other Friday. Pay is every two weeks.

How do you calculate a pay period? Determine the start and end date of the pay period. Count the number of days/hours worked during the pay period. Multiply the number of days/hours worked by the employee's daily rate/hourly wage to calculate the gross pay for the pay period.
